Preferred Label : Sabatolimab;

NCIt synonyms : Anti-TIM3 Checkpoint Inhibitor MBG453; Anti-TIM-3 Monoclonal Antibody MBG453;

NCIt definition : An inhibitor of the inhibitory T-cell receptor T-cell immunoglobulin and mucin domain-containing protein 3 (TIM-3; hepatitis A virus cellular receptor 2; HAVCR2), with potential immune checkpoint inhibitory and antineoplastic activities. Upon administration, sabatolimab binds to TIM-3 expressed on certain immune cells, including tumor infiltrating lymphocytes (TILs). This abrogates T-cell inhibition, activates antigen-specific T-lymphocytes and enhances cytotoxic T-cell-mediated tumor cell lysis resulting in a reduction in tumor growth. TIM-3, a transmembrane protein expressed on certain T-cells, is associated with tumor-mediated immune suppression.;
